salut j'ai une erreur de undefined variable:
"Notice: Undefined variable: nombredepages in C:\wamp\www\petite annonce\model\recherche.php on line 517"
voici la parti de la ligne concerné
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28 <?php $nombre_de_page_a_gauche_et_a_droite=4; if ($nombredepages!=1) { if ($pageActuelle>1) { $retour=$pageActuelle-1; echo '<a href="../model/recherche.php?page='.$retou.'> precedent </a>'; for ($i=$pageActuelle-$nombre_de_page_a_gauche_et_a_droite; $i<$pageActuelle ; $i++) { if ($i>0) { echo '<a href="../model/recherche.php?page='.$i.'">'.$i.'</a>'; } } } echo '<p>'.$pageActuelle.'</p>'; for ($i=$pageActuelle+1; $i <$nombredepages ; $i++) { echo '<a href="../model/recherche.php?page='.$i.'">'.$i.'</a>'; } if ($i>=$pageActuelle+$nombre_de_page_a_gauche_et_a_droite) { break; } if ($pageActuelle!=$nombredepages) { $suivant=$pageActuelle+1; echo'<a href="../model/recherche.php?page='.$suivant.'">suivant</a>'; } } ?>
voicis la ligne qui definir une valeur a $nombresdepage
mercie d'avance
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13 <?php $messagesParPage=15; //Nous allons afficher 15 messages par page. //Une connexion SQL doit être ouverte avant cette ligne... $retour_total=$bdd->prepare('SELECT COUNT(*) AS nb_produit FROM produitbdd ORDER BY id DESC'); $donnees_total=$retour_total->fetch(); //On range retour sous la forme d'un tableau. $total=$donnees_total['nb_produit']; //On récupère le total pour le placer dans la variable $total. //Nous allons maintenant compter le nombre de pages. $nombreDePages=ceil($total/$messagesParPage); ?>







Répondre avec citation
Partager